He had the top transfer class in the Group of 5 last year. It's becoming the new thing. CSU hired a GM from Ole Miss. I think the trend is to try and build NFL style front offices to take care of all the personnel matters and leave the coaches to focus on coaching. The coach won't be involved in the player payroll at all. Obviously they still answer to the AD, and the coach is involved in some decisions but not the financial ones. We also hired a director of scouting for defense, and have an opening for the same role on offense. In addition they hired the ex-Steelers GM as a consultant to help get all of this organized. With NIL, rev share, and the portal the personnel side of CFB has become big enough that an NFL style front office seems to make sense. 2 Quote
